Cindy and Bobby started running together along a cross country track. When Bobby completed the track in 43 minutes, Cindy had run only
13 of the track. Cindy’s average speed was 114 m/min slower than Bobby’s.
- How long was the cross country track in m?
- Find Cindy’s average speed in m/min.
(a)
When Bobby completed the track:
Bobby's distance = 3 u
Cindy's distance = 1 u
Extra distance covered by Bobby
= 3 u - 1 u
= 2 u
2 u = 114 x 43
2 u = 4902
1 u = 4902 ÷ 2 = 2451
Distance of the cross country track
= 3 u
= 3 x 2451
= 7353 m
(b)
Bobby's speed
= 7353 ÷ 43
= 171 m/min
Cindy's speed
= 171 - 114
= 57 m/min
Answer(s): (a) 7353 m; (b) 57 m/min
